先看下面这段代码,显然无法work. 因为代码试图在TestVariableScope()中引用一个没有被定义的变量a.所以必须报错,如下图-1. 不过如果你将第2行代码注释掉。代码就能跑通了,如图-2。 问题1来了:TestVariableScope.a 不是也没有被定义 ...
解决办法: 写OC的时候常常会用到各种宏定义,但是Swift中貌似没有宏的这种定义,更多的是通过全局常量或者全局函数来实现这一效果.我们只需要建立一个文件 假设为Macro.swift ,把想用的定义在里面,无须导入头文件什么的,就可以在全局用啦. ...
2016-03-23 20:22 0 3538 推荐指数:
先看下面这段代码,显然无法work. 因为代码试图在TestVariableScope()中引用一个没有被定义的变量a.所以必须报错,如下图-1. 不过如果你将第2行代码注释掉。代码就能跑通了,如图-2。 问题1来了:TestVariableScope.a 不是也没有被定义 ...
1.链接:https://www.douban.com/note/603963620/ 2.例题: (1) ...
https://www.cnblogs.com/wanghetao/p/4492582.html https://www.cnblogs.com/Dageking/p/3185230.html h ...
1如果在函数中,变量前加了global,很显然该变量是全局变量 2如果函数中的一个变量和全局变量的名称相同,但是函数没有给这个变量赋值,那么这个变量是全局变量 3如果函数中的一个变量和全局变量的名称相同,但是函数给该变量赋值了,这个变量就是局部变量 4如果函数中的变量没有与之同名的全局变量 ...
全局变量和全局函数是相对局部变量和局部函数而言的,不在{}或者for, if 等范围内的都是全局变量或者全局函数,最简单的是在同一个文件中去声明。 例如在mian.cpp中 #include <iostream> int gResult; int gAdd(int ...
定义使用全局变量,全局函数 ...
配置了一个 “PASSWORD”的变量值 然后再脚本里面使用 注意这里必须要用双引号 不然不行 ...
在main.js中 例子 ...